What is a Switch Outlet Combo Wiring Diagram and How Are They Used?

A Switch Outlet Combo Wiring Diagram illustrates the electrical connections within a device that combines a standard wall switch with one or more electrical outlets. These units are commonly found in residential and commercial settings, offering convenience by providing both switching and power supply in a single location. For instance, you might find a switch controlling an overhead light and an outlet below it for plugging in lamps or other devices, all within the same wall plate and electrical box. The importance of correctly interpreting this diagram cannot be overstated for electrical safety and preventing damage to appliances or wiring.

These combo units offer several advantages in electrical installations:

  • Space-saving: Reduces the number of wall boxes needed in a room.
  • Convenience: Integrates lighting control with power outlets.
  • Versatility: Can be wired in various configurations to suit different needs.

Let's look at some common scenarios for their use:

  1. Controlling an Overhead Light: The switch operates a ceiling light, while the outlet remains constantly powered or is controlled by a different circuit.
  2. Controlling a Switched Outlet: The switch controls a specific outlet, allowing you to easily turn power on and off to a connected device like a lamp without unplugging it.
  3. Multi-Circuit Applications: In more complex setups, the switch and outlet might be on entirely separate circuits, requiring careful attention to the diagram's specific wire routing.
